JavaWeb物资管理系统源码:实战项目参考与毕业设计指南

版权申诉
0 下载量 84 浏览量 更新于2024-10-15 收藏 11.71MB ZIP 举报
资源摘要信息:"JavaWeb物资管理系统项目源码是一份基于JavaWeb技术实现的完整物资管理系统代码。该系统主要涉及物资的采购、库存和销售管理,目的是帮助企业实现物资管理的规范化和高效率。系统采用了JavaWeb的核心技术,包括但不限于Servlet、JSP、JavaBean和JSTL,保证了代码的高质量与良好的系统架构设计。 详细知识点如下: 1. JavaWeb基础与框架: - JavaWeb是Java技术应用于Web开发领域的一套解决方案,它包括一系列用于开发和部署动态Web应用程序的技术和标准。 - Servlet是JavaWeb的核心组件,负责处理客户端请求并生成响应。它是运行在服务器端的小型Java程序,可以创建动态内容。 - JSP(JavaServer Pages)允许开发者将Java代码嵌入到HTML页面中,用于生成动态Web页面。 - JavaBean是一种特殊的Java类,其设计目的是为了实现业务逻辑、数据访问或用于其他Java程序的组件重用。 - JSTL(JavaServer Pages Standard Tag Library)是一种用于扩展JSP的标签库,它提供了一套标准的标签来简化JSP页面的编写。 2. 物资管理系统的核心功能: - 采购管理:实现物资采购流程的自动化,包括需求申请、采购订单、入库验收和供应商管理等。 - 库存管理:监控库存水平,实现库存状态的实时更新,包括库存查询、入库出库、库存报警等。 - 销售管理:处理销售订单,跟踪销售数据,管理客户信息,以及销售预测和分析。 3. 系统架构设计: - MVC架构模式(Model-View-Controller)是JavaWeb开发中常用的架构模式。该模式将应用程序分为三个核心组件:模型(处理数据)、视图(处理用户界面)、控制器(接收用户输入并调用模型和视图组件处理数据)。 - 系统设计时,需考虑到模块的解耦合、系统的可扩展性、安全性和性能优化。 4. 实战能力提升: - 通过学习源码,开发者可以加深对JavaWeb编程的理解,提升解决实际问题的能力。 - 源码中的设计模式和编程思想对于提高代码的可维护性和可读性有很好的帮助。 5. 毕业设计与创新: - 此源码可以作为毕业设计的参考,学习者可以根据自己的需求进行定制化开发,加入新的功能或优化现有流程。 - 鼓励学生在此基础上发挥创新精神,例如引入机器学习算法优化库存预测,或者开发移动应用程序作为系统的前端。 6. 适用范围与价值: - JavaWeb物资管理系统项目源码具有较强的实用价值,适用于不同规模的企业,可帮助其建立完善的物资管理体系。 - 该系统对于JavaWeb开发者而言,是学习和实践的良好资源,可以加深对JavaWeb技术及其在实际业务中应用的理解。 综合以上内容,JavaWeb物资管理系统项目源码不仅是学习者提升技能的良好材料,同时对于教育工作者而言,也是培养学生实践能力的优秀教材。对于企业用户来说,该系统能够快速部署并根据自身需求进行调整,以适应不断变化的业务环境和市场需求。"